Apple iPod Shuffle 3rd Generation — 3.7V Li-Polymer Replacement Battery (616-0429)
This is a 3.7V, 73mAh Li-Polymer replacement battery for the Apple iPod Shuffle 3rd Generation. It fits the clip-based Shuffle — the model without a screen, controlled by the inline remote on the headphone cable. The OEM part number is 616-0429.
- 3rd Generation Shuffle fit: The 3rd Gen Shuffle uses a smaller cell format than the 2nd or 4th Gen. The 616-0429 matches the correct cell dimensions (26.19 × 13.79 × 3.49mm) and connector orientation. Swapping a cell from a different generation will not fit the board correctly.
- Bench tested on actual hardware: We ran this cell through charge and discharge cycles on a 3rd Gen Shuffle. The BMS accepted charge current without fault flags. Voltage held steady across playback load and tapered cleanly into the low-voltage cutoff threshold.
- Post-swap charge behaviour: After installing a new cell, plug the Shuffle into iTunes via USB rather than a wall adapter first. The 3rd Gen Shuffle relies on the USB host for its initial charge handshake — a wall adapter alone may not start current flow on a freshly installed cell.
Why the iPod Shuffle 3rd Gen goes dark after weeks in a drawer
At 73mAh, this cell has very little reserve capacity. Stored without a charge for more than a few weeks, the cell voltage can drop below the BMS protection threshold — typically around 2.5V. When that happens, the Shuffle will not respond to the power button at all. Connect it to a powered USB port and leave it for 30 to 45 minutes before attempting to power on. The BMS needs a trickle current to recover the cell voltage above the wake threshold before it will pass normal charge current.
Playback cutting out before the status light shows low battery
This happens because the audio amplifier in the Shuffle draws a short current spike when driving headphones, and near the end of discharge the cell voltage sags under that load. The BMS reads the sag as a cutoff condition and shuts down before the indicator registers empty. It is not a faulty cell — it is the cell reaching its usable floor. After a full charge cycle, the behaviour resets. If cutouts start much earlier than expected after a new cell install, verify the solder joints on the battery connector tabs are not adding resistance to the circuit.
